The last Father's Day card...


I have always struggled with guy cards/pages, so Father's Day is a toughie for me...but I got 'em all done! Here's a peek at the card I made for my hubby. I based the design off of this week's sketch at Card Positioning Systems. The embossing is the Cuttlebug Diamond Plate folder, the arrow is Tim Holtz Grungeboard, and I inked and distressed the card and arrow with Tim Holtz Distress Inks. Thanks for looking!

A card to make you "Smile" and a SALE! (to make you smile MORE!)


I made this card for several challenges: it was inspired by this week's Tuesday Trigger at Moxie Fab, and based on a Page Maps challenge on 2Peas. I used a digistamp from Lindsay's Stamp Stuff- Birds and Branches set, and Lindsay's Shabby Green Houndstooth digipaper. The cardstock base is a Crinkle Texture cardstock from Wasau paper, and the 2 green cardstock tags are a scrap of C'oredinations, and I ran the one on the bottom through the Cuttlebug with the Diamond Plate folder. I colored the digistamp with colored pencils on the branch and leaves first, and used some shimmery light blue chalks by Pebbles, Inc. to give the look of sky.I cut the tags out the old fashioned way, with a template, inked the edges of everything with green ink and Walnut Stain, added the ribbon, and ...viola!Pretty quick and easy card!
